Ellen Newbold La Motte’s 'Civilization: Tales of the Orient' offers a compelling glimpse into the cultural landscape where East meets West. Through a series of evocative short stories, La Motte explores the complex interactions and often jarring cultural clashes that arise when different worlds collide.These carefully crafted tales paint a vivid picture of Asian culture and its encounter with Western influences. La Motte’s work, originally published in the 20th century, captures the nuances of cultural exchange with a keen eye and subtle understanding.This collection provides a unique perspective on a timeless theme, inviting readers to reflect on the enduring power of cultural heritage and the challenges of navigating a world shaped by diverse perspectives. 'Civilization' remains a relevant and insightful exploration of the human experience, reminding us of the importance of empathy and understanding in a globalized world.This work has been selected by scholars as being culturally important, and is part of the knowledge base of civilization as we know it.This work is in the public domain in the United States of America, and possibly other nations.
